Our apprentices follow a three-year training programme, with day release college attendance. This is a full-time role, Monday-Friday.


The Modern Apprentice will function under the overall guidance of the Apprentice Coordinator but also on a day-to-day basis be managed by the Team Leader / Supervisor in charge of the department where the Apprentices' current training is taking place.


For the duration of the Apprenticeship at GE Caledonian, you will gain practical experience, develop theoretical knowledge, whilst obtaining formal qualifications, which are recognised and fully transferrable within the Aerospace industry.

You will perform multiple aspects of maintenance and repair to the highest quality. Excellent communication skills are required, along with the ability to accurately follow work process instructions. You will have a keen sense of achievement and take pride in the work you undertake and produce. The ability to work efficiently within a team is essential.
